The Edmark Reading Program ensures success to students of all ages who have not yet mastered beginning reading. This approach eliminates incorrect responses and helps students view themselves as readers. The key to this success is the program's use of a carefully sequenced, highly repetitive word recognition method combined with errorless learning. Widely regarded as the "one that works," the Edmark Reading Program has long helped students who need an alternative to phonics.
